Our class motto is "Never Settle for Less than Your Best!" I want my students to become effective communicators who collaborate, expand on their creativity, and enhance their critical thinking skills. I want to prepare my students for 21st century learning, but lack some skills to do so.
I've enjoyed being an upper grade teacher for the past 10 years.
I have always taught at Title 1 schools and I wouldn't change it for anything. It is absolutely the best sparking the interests of 10 year-olds in various subjects while helping them surpass their potential. Since my students are of the video game generation, technology is the ultimate tool that helps me engage them. When I first taught 5th grade in California, the iPad just came out. The school I taught at there was equipped with Apple products which my students used to create projects like vocabulary videos. Some of the videos were even showcased in a local Technology Showcase as well as in the Santa Barbara Film Festival. Half a decade later, the iPad is still a dynamic tool used in classrooms. In fact, my current students have been blessed with some iPads through Donors Choose. However, technology is always changing and becoming more innovative faster than I am able to teach my students how to effectively use.
My Project
I am requesting a Mac mini so I can learn lessons from iTunes U and other professional development sites on how to make the best use of the iPads and other technology within my classroom for lessons, projects and presentations. Before I can teach my students effectively and efficiently, I need to educate myself. I now teach 5th grade in Virginia, but my current school is equipped with PCs that are not as easily compatible with the iPads. A Mac mini and a keyboard would provide me a learning station that has compatible hardware and software with our iPads. In addition, I am requesting a couple of professional development books that would aid in my quest to continue "flipping my classroom" to maximize learning within my students with technology.
These tools will most definitely help me become a more effective and efficient educator for my students.
These materials I am requesting will allow me to grow professionally in the area of technology. I look forward to how these skills will enable me to be a better guide for my 21st century learners!
